It was a good run, but Point Arena unfortunately witnessed the end of their six-game winning streak on Friday. They lost 5-1 to the Calistoga Wildcats. The Pirates were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Wildcats apparently hadn't forgotten their defeat the last time these teams played back in September.
Point Arena's goal came courtesy of
Jael Orsini, who's now up to eight this season.
Point Arena's loss ended a three-game streak of away wins and brought them to 10-5. As for Calistoga, they are on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six games, which provided a massive bump to their 9-3-2 record this season.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Point Arena will welcome Tomales at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. Point Arena will be looking to keep their seven-game home win streak alive.
